Common Issues with Sliding Doors
Sliding doors are mostly made up of 2 primary parts: the door itself and the track system. In time, both can come across problems. Here are some typical problems related to sliding doors:
IssueDescriptionHard to Open/CloseExcess dirt or debris on the track can hinder operation.MisalignmentThe door may slide off the track due to incorrect installation or wear.Broken RollersWorn or damaged rollers might cause the door to jam or avoid.Harmed TrackA bent or broken track can prevent smooth operation.Sticking DoorDoors that stick might have paint or debris obstructing the edges.Weather Stripping WearOld weather condition removing can let air, bugs, or wetness in.Glass Panel IssuesCracks or chips in the glass might require replacement.Step-by-Step Sliding Door Repair ProcessTools and Materials Needed

2. Cleaning Track and Rollers
Start your repair process by cleaning up the track and rollers:
Remove the Door: Lift the door off the track if possible. This may involve unscrewing or unclipping the rollers at the bottom.Tidy the Track: Use a vacuum to get rid of any dirt and debris from the track. Follow up with a wet fabric and, if necessary, a mild detergent.Clean the Rollers: Check for dirt or debris jammed in the rollers. Clean them thoroughly also.3. Replacing Rollers
If cleansing doesn't solve the issue, you might need to change the rollers:
Remove Old Rollers: If the rollers are harmed, unscrew them from the door.Install New Rollers: Attach the replacement rollers securely to the door.Reattach the Door: Carefully lift the door back onto the track and test the operation.4. Adjusting Door Alignment
Next, inspect the door positioning:
Check the Tracks: Ensure that the track is level. If it has bent or become unequal, it may require replacing.Change Roller Height: Most rollers have a modification screw that raises or lowers the door. Change as essential to guarantee smooth operation.5. Repairing or Replacing Weather Stripping
If weather stripping is worn, change it for enhanced energy efficiency:
Remove Old Weather Stripping: Pull away the old product gently.Clean the Area: Ensure the surface area is clean for adhesion.Use New Weather Stripping: Measure and cut the brand-new stripping to size, then connect it firmly.6. Glass Repair (if required)
If the glass panel is cracked or harmed, repair it properly:
Assess Damage: Determine if the glass can be repaired or requires replacement.Repair or Replace: Use a glass repair set for minor fractures, or consult a professional for larger concerns.Maintenance Tips for Sliding Doors
Regular maintenance can help avoid the requirement for regular repairs. Here are some tips:
Regular Cleaning: Clean the tracks and rollers at least every couple of months.Lubrication: Apply a silicone-based lube to the tracks and rollers to ensure smooth movement.Check Weather Stripping: Inspect and change weather condition stripping as required to preserve energy effectiveness.Tighten up Hardware: Periodically examine screws and fittings to ensure everything is firmly secured.FAQ: Sliding Door RepairQ1: How often should I clean my sliding door tracks?

Q2: Can I change the glass myself?
If you're comfortable and have the right tools, you can replace the glass. Nevertheless, employing a professional may be safer for larger panes or intricate doors.
Q3: What type of lube is best for sliding doors?
A silicone-based lube is recommended because it doesn't attract dirt and securely keeps the tracks and rollers moving efficiently.
Q4: My sliding door is still tough to operate after cleaning. What should I do?
Misalignment or harmed rollers may need attention. If you've cleaned and the door is still difficult to operate, think about examining the rollers or having a professional examine the alignment.
Q5: Are there any indications that suggest I should replace my sliding door?
Indications include substantial physical damage to the door, consistent operational problems after repair work, or damaged glass. If repair expenses go beyond replacement, it's time to consider a brand-new door.
